Welcome to team Quillback! Quick context for the sync: Marisol fixed the N+1 mess in the OrderHistory resolver by batching through a dataloader, so we're no longer hammering Postgres 400 times per page. Her branch ships Thursday. To deploy the fix yourself, you'll need to sign the release manifest with the following key.

release key, kawif-hawep: bky13_X7TGuRG4Zu4ZJ

## Fuel Report Job

Nightly job pulls odometer and pump logs from the Cartwheel fleet API, aggregates liters-per-route, writes CSV to the reports bucket. Runs at 02:10 local. If totals look off, check for trucks with stale telemetry first — that's the usual cause. Schema changes go through the Haverly team. Do not backfill more than 30 days per run; the upstream API throttles hard. The job authenticates to Cartwheel with the key below.

service key, fawip-bajef: kto11_Qt5wZK9vdNC

Account recovery — Meridel calendar sync conflict. If a user's Meridel account locks after duplicate sync events from Pallwick Scheduler, do not delete the conflicting calendar. Pause sync, clear the event cache, then run the recovery flow from the admin panel. You'll need the recovery passphrase below.

strongbox words: norwyn-wenael-aldvan-aldiel-wendor-holael